Intellectual Property Insurance Services Corp. (IPISC), based in Louisville, Kentucky, has appointed Sandra Walker as vice president of Litigation Management.
Walker’s chief responsibility is to assist Insureds with the management of their intellectual property litigation.
IPISC’s insurance offers products designed to help safeguard a company’s intellectual property and its right to sell products. The Abatement (Enforcement) policy reimburses the litigation expenses to enforce a company’s IP against alleged infringers. The Defense policy reimburses the litigation expenses to defend against charges of infringing another’s IP rights by the products or services the Insured is selling, and can cover potential damages or settlements.
